diff options
author | einhverfr <einhverfr@4979c152-3d1c-0410-bac9-87ea11338e46> | 2007-03-09 23:44:20 +0000 |
---|---|---|
committer | einhverfr <einhverfr@4979c152-3d1c-0410-bac9-87ea11338e46> | 2007-03-09 23:44:20 +0000 |
commit | 8af0c5a7d5b6b6720ac12251f50897f6ee3f1b63 (patch) | |
tree | 456ea5f732bd70fe91dc489dffaa100cbe281819 /LedgerSMB/DBObject.pm | |
parent | 8327a4959a98ad10eb38974aaaddaa1ff7624bda (diff) |
Employee.pm is now working as advertised
git-svn-id: https://ledger-smb.svn.sourceforge.net/svnroot/ledger-smb/trunk@872 4979c152-3d1c-0410-bac9-87ea11338e46
Diffstat (limited to 'LedgerSMB/DBObject.pm')
-rw-r--r-- | LedgerSMB/DBObject.pm |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/LedgerSMB/DBObject.pm b/LedgerSMB/DBObject.pm index beb95fb2..54b34429 100644 --- a/LedgerSMB/DBObject.pm +++ b/LedgerSMB/DBObject.pm @@ -68,20 +68,21 @@ sub exec_method { die; } my $m_name = $ref->{proname}; + my @call_args; if ($args){ for my $arg (@proc_args){ if ($arg =~ s/^in_//){ print "Arg: $arg\n"; - push @proc_args, $self->{$arg}; + push @call_args, $self->{$arg}; } } } else { - @proc_args = @_; + @call_args = @_; } print "Arg2s: @_ \n"; - $self->callproc($funcname, @proc_args); + $self->callproc($funcname, @call_args); } 1; |